She sang one line off key and nobody re recorded it. Made with MiniMax H3 Prompt: ULTRA REALISTIC 15 SECOND PERSONAL HOME VIDEO. 1080p render of 4:3 early 2000s MiniDV tape footage. Single continuous handheld take, no cuts. Sung Hindi vocal, diegetic performance. Title: TERI AADAT. CONCEPT Dusk on a terrace. A young man plays an old acoustic guitar sitting on the parapet, and the young woman sings along with him, badly and happily, halfway through a verse. Their friend is filming on a camcorder from a few feet away. It is a love song but nobody is performing a love song, they are just two people killing an evening and the tape happened to be running. SUBJECT LOCK ONE Indian woman, early twenties, warm medium brown skin. Realistic skin with visible pores, faint under eye shadow, minimal makeup, slight shine on the forehead in the low sun. Dark brown hair loosely tied back with strands pulling loose in the wind. Oversized cream knit sweater with stretched cuffs, blue jeans, white sneakers scuffed at the toe. Same face, same hair, same outfit held identically for the full 15 seconds. Sitting cross legged on a folded mat, knees tucked, unposed and slightly slouched. SUBJECT LOCK TWO Indian man, early twenties, medium brown skin, short unstyled hair, faint stubble. Faded olive shirt with sleeves pushed to the elbows, dark jeans, worn sandals. Sitting on the low parapet with a scratched acoustic guitar across his lap, head down watching his own fingers, glancing up at her twice. SETTING Open concrete terrace of an older residential building, autumn evening. Low parapet with peeling paint, a black water tank, a sagging clothesline with nothing on it, dry leaves in one corner. Beyond the parapet, a dense low rise neighbourhood of flat roofs, cables and water tanks, hazy warm sun almost down. Lived in and unstyled. No visible brands, no logos, no readable signage anywhere in frame. CAMERA Raw handheld MiniDV camcorder held by a friend sitting a few feet away, angle slightly low and off center. Autofocus hunting between the guitar strings and her face. Exposure pumping as the lens drifts toward the bright sky and back down. One slow unmotivated zoom in on her, overshooting so her forehead is cropped, then correcting. Framing keeps both of them in shot but never composes them nicely. Mild tape noise, interlace combing on fast movement, one brief tape dropout glitch. No stabilization, no gimbal, no cinematic choreography, no rack focus. BEATS 0:00 to 0:04 He is already mid strum. She listens with her chin on her knee, mouthing the words before she commits to singing them. 0:04 to 0:10 She sings the first two lines properly, off pitch on the second, and laughs at herself without stopping. He keeps playing and grins down at the guitar. 0:10 to 0:13 She sings the last two lines quieter, watching him instead of the camera. He looks up at her once. Neither reacts, no kiss, no held gaze, they both look away. 0:13 to 0:15 The guitar rings out unresolved, she pulls her sleeve over her hand, wind hits the mic, tape cuts. VOCAL AND LYRICS Original composition, not an existing song. Spoken and sung language locked to Hindi. Single female voice, untrained, close and unmixed, sung at conversational volume. 0:04 Dheere dheere shaam dhalti hai 0:07 Kuch bhi nahi kehna aaj 0:10 Teri aadat si ho gayi hai 0:12 Rehne de, bas yahi theek hai Precise lipsync to the sung line, bilabial closure on the m, b and p sounds, jaw and throat movement consistent with singing rather than speaking. Slight breath before each line. No harmony, no second voice, no backing vocal. AUDIO Diegetic only. The acoustic guitar visible in frame is the only instrument, recorded on the camcorder mic so it is thin and boxy. Her voice, wind across the terrace clipping the mic, guitar body knocks, crows, a distant pressure horn, a television faint from a floor below, faint hand noise on the camcorder body. No studio track, no backing music, no reverb, no score, no added ambience beds. STYLE RULES Nothing dramatic happens on purpose. No lip biting, no slow motion hair, no romantic staging, no golden hour beauty lighting, no lingering eye contact, no music video choreography. The romance is only in the fact that neither of them looks at the camera. Realism comes from the off pitch line, the imperfect framing, and the unresolved chord at the end. If either of them performs for the lens the illusion breaks. NEGATIVE No music track. No subtitles. No captions. No watermark. No timestamp burn in. No slow motion. No color grading. No lens flare. No shallow depth of field. No crowd. No third visible person. No brand logos. No readable text. LAST FRAME Wide slightly crooked frame of both of them on the terrace with the sun gone and the sky flat blue, image tears with one frame of tape distortion, then hard cut to black. Absolutely no on screen text, no title card, no lettering, no numbers, no logo, no signage of any kind in the final frame.
